Orange Physiotherapy Vipers claimed a massive win over OHS Hornets in the Orange Netball Association's Toyota Cup on Saturday in a three-point thriller thanks to a massive 23-point second quarter.

The Lynne Middleton-coached outfit turned a 12-2 quarter time deficit into a 25-18 half time lead in one of the side's best quarters of 2019.
However, the Hornets whittled that seven-point lead back to just four points at the final break before a hectic final quarter saw the students throw everything they had at the Vipers in a match which turned to a tense finish, which Middleton jokingly said "took three years off my life".
"It was very tight towards the end when they came at us ... Hornets are a good team, a young team and they're improving," Middleton said.
"We did allow them to come back in after we made a lot of unforced errors but they steadied in the final few minutes."
The second-point spark was a whole-team effort according to Middleton, with the defensive efforts across the court lifting, with Teigan Colley's rebounds and shooting crucial up front, Bridie McClure controlling centre court and Bec Kwa dominant down back.
"Our defensive circle of Kwa, the evergreen Sheryll Selwood and Abby Tilburg were excellent," she said.
While the win wasn't massive in margin, it was huge in magnitude for the rest of the season, with the Vipers leapfrogging the Hornets to slide into third place, equal on points with the students but ahead on percentage.
"We know we've got to pull back some of those losses from the first half of the year and make sure we keep in the top four," Middleton said.
"We've got lots of teams nipping at our heels, especially the Life Studio sides."
In the other games, Life Studio defeated their clubmates Mid West Eyes 49-36, Craig Harvey Mechanical claimed a massive win over Hawks Royals 60-28, while Orange City Epiroc and Life Studio Sportspower's clash was deferred.
